Understanding Mental Illness in Alpine, NJ
Any condition that causes troubling thoughts, behaviors, and emotions in a negative way can be considered a mental illness. Because all of our self-worth and communications are dependent on our mental health, it is detrimental that we take care of Mental Illness when we become aware of it. If someone has difficulty processing their thoughts and emotions effectively, feelings of loneliness and low self-esteem can begin to surface. Sadly, it is also common for individuals to turn to substance abuse to self-medicate. When this happens, their mental Illness may go untreated for years—resulting in a much more dire situation. In the event that mental illness leads to substance use concerns, we usually suggest looking for a Dual Diagnosis facility. This way, both Mental Illness and substance abuse can be treated simultaneously.
How to Select a Mental Health Provider in Alpine, NJ
When picking a mental health provider in Alpine, NJ , the most important thing is to properly assess the individual's needs. Most commonly, we recommend beginning with what you already knowz, because denial is a regular side effect. So first, start by considering the individual’s current mental health status and if they are taking any types of mind altering substances. Suppose chemical substances are a factor, then choosing a dual diagnosis treatment facility for co-occurring disorders would be recommended. Once a mental health rehab facility has been chosen, the next thing is to to allow the provider to complete an initial assessment. Most facilities will have a an in-depth and intensive evaluation. These evaluations are used to confirm that the patient is an ideal fit for their program, as well as help direct the clinical staff on the individual needs of the patient.

Paying for Alpine Mental Health Services
When considering paying for mental health treatment, most individuals will have a few different options based upon their financial needs. Start by speaking with your insurance provider and having them provide recommendations based on the coverage in your plan documents. Option 2 is out-of-pocket payment. This is a typical option for people who select a mental health rehab not covered by their insurance, or in the absence of healthcare coverage. Option 3 is receiving treatment at a state-funded mental health rehab. This may be the best option for those who are uninsured or have limited financial resources.
